These have been a regular in our rotation for years. It is so easy to throw together before work. I use homemade taco seasoning instead of packaged fajita seasoning--it's more cost effective and cuts down on the sodium. I also use mango peach salsa. Yum! I recently made this for my sister, who didn't even sit at the dining table: she stood at the kitchen counter right next to the slow cooker, and kept re-filling her plate until she ate 4 helpings!

This is really good. The salsa sortof "melts" into the sauce. So, for those of you who have picky eaters that don't like "chunks" of vegies, then this recipe is for you. I left out the peppers and onions and just stir fried a few for anyone who wanted them while assembling. Buy a big jar of salsa so you can use the left over for assembly also. Makes alot so it is good for a big family.
